A secretary was making name tags. She made each name tag from an index card which was cut into ¼ s. How many name tags can the s

ecretary make with 2 index cards?
A. 8 Since each card will be cut into 1/4s and there are four 1/4s in 1 we can multiply 4 by two since there are two index cards to get the total number of name tags she can make.

B. 2 ¼ The secretary has two index cards and cuts them into 1/4s. We can combine the whole number of cards with the fraction she will cut them into to get the number she will have when done.

C. 3/8 Since we have a fraction she will cut them into and a whole number of cards we need to get two fractions. By putting 2 over 4 we can add directly across.

D. ½ To get the total number of name tags the secretary can make out of two index cards we need to multiply the total number of index cards by the fraction she is going to cut them into.

The general form of a geometric progression or geometric sequence is a, ar, ar², ar³ and so on.

where,

  • a = first term
  • r = common ratio

<u>The formula to find the nth term in GP is :</u>

nth term = ar^{n-1}

The given sequence 6,18,54.

In this sequence,

  • The first term, a = 6
  • The common ratio, r = 18/6 = 3

5th term = 6\times3^{5-1}

⇒ 6\times3^{4}

⇒ 6\times81

⇒ 486

Therefore, after 5 years the population will be 486.
